Cashier

Job Description/PURPOSE OF POSITION:


The Cashier position is responsible for executing the Schlotzsky’s Brand Standards to ensure successful operations, Guest service and achievement of financial targets.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include, but is not limited to:

1. Take Customer Orders & Accurately enter orders into the POS system.

2. Responsible for the assigned maintenance of Drink station Booth, Cinnabon Station Booth, Dining Room Station & Restrooms.
3. Must become familiar with and adhere to all Company policies and procedures.

4. Maintain a positive attitude towards customers & coworkers.

4 Comply with Schlotzsy’s policies and procedures by working at our pace to maintain restaurant’s established speed of service guidelines.

GENERAL AND P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:

Must be at least 18 years of age in order to operate certain kitchen equipment.
Should be proficient and knowledgeable of procedures for all guest service stations.
Essential functions of the position include, but is not limited to:
Lifting and carrying objects weighing up to 50 pounds.
Lifting a full 33-gallon trash bag from trash container.
Standing and walking throughout a scheduled shift.
Bending, stretching, reaching, pushing and kneeling to reach certain products or clean certain areas of the restaurant.
Performing repetitive hand and arm motions.
Certain job functions require ability to perform repetitive slicing motions with a sharp knife.
Certain job functions require ability to handle hot food by hand for several seconds at a time, throughout a scheduled shift.

Assistant Manager
Job Description

PURPOSE OF POSITION:

The Assistant Manager is responsible for assisting the Schlotzsky’s management team in all aspects of shift management to ensure successful operations, Guest service and achievement of financial targets.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:

Financial

Assists GM with effectively communicating weekly and period variances from budgets compared to in-store and final P&L’s.
Communicates financial goals to employees and provides direction to achieve those goals.
Executes proper security and cash handling and control procedures and holds cashiers accountable to adhering to policies and procedures.
Assists GM with performing daily and weekly inventories accurately and timely.
Assists GM with performing accurate end-of-period inventories.
Assists GM with placing food, produce, paper, and supply orders in a timely manner to ensure proper levels are maintained at all times.
Works in tandem with GM to consistently maintain labor, food and supplies costs within budget.
Utilizes and maintains all reporting and tracking systems for financial results. (Menulink)
Maintains high level of integrity in all financial reporting.

People Development

Provides clear direction and leadership to all Team Leaders and employees.
Serves as a role model to all employees by setting the example and maintaining professionalism in the restaurant.
Promotes an "Open Door Policy" in the restaurant and is accessible to all employees.
Interviews hourly employee candidates and makes hiring recommendations to General Manager.
Assists General Manager with new hire orientation and new employee training.
Submits hourly employee new hire paperwork, New Hire/Change Forms, Termination Notification Forms, and bi-weekly payroll spreadsheets to Payroll and/or Human Resources in a timely manner.
Ensures that systems, materials and people are in place to provide for quality employee training.
Assists with minimizes employee turnover by:
selecting and recommending candidates who possess pre-designed characteristics and have a good work history;
being involved in the orientation and training of all new employees;
providing a positive work environment for all employees;
identifying and addressing employee issues in a timely manner.
Assists with conducting monthly safety training for all management and hourly employees and forwards acknowledgement forms to Human Resources in a timely manner.
Consistently counsels and properly documents performance, attendance, or behavioral issues encountered with all hourly employees.
Assists GM with maintaining proper employee staffing levels in the restaurant at all times.
Assists GM with preparing hourly employee performance appraisals.
Assists GM with hourly employee performance counseling and terminations.
Operates the restaurant with uncompromising integrity and superior credibility, adhering at all times to the Schlotzsky’s policies and procedures.

General Manager
Job Description

PURPOSE OF POSITION:

The General Manager is responsible for providing outstanding leadership to the restaurant team. In addition, the General Manager is responsible for achieving targeted results related to exceptional guest service, sales growth, profitability, people development, management of quality/service/cleanliness standards, facility maintenance, and local store marketing.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:

Financial

Effectively communicates budget variances.
Communicates financial goals to the management team and employees and provides direction to achieve those goals.
Uses proper planning and formulates realistic goals for achieving budgeted financial results.
Executes proper security and cash handling and control procedures and hold managers and cashiers accountable to adhering to policies and procedures.
Performs or delegates daily and weekly inventories accurately and timely.
Performs accurate end-of-period inventories.
Places food, produce, paper, and supply orders in a timely manner to ensure proper levels are maintained at all times.
Consistently maintains labor, food and supplies costs within budget.
Utilizes and maintains all reporting and tracking systems for financial results. (Menulink)
Maintains high level of integrity in all financial reporting.

People Development

Provides clear direction and leadership to all managers and employees during each shift.
Serves as a role model to all employees and managers by setting the example and maintaining professionalism in the restaurant.
Promotes an "Open Door Policy" in the restaurant and is accessible to all employees.
Interviews hourly employee candidates and makes hiring decisions.
Conducts new hire orientation and on-boarding.
Submits hourly employee new hire paperwork, New Hire/Change Forms, Termination Notification Forms, and bi-weekly payroll spreadsheets to Payroll and/or Human Resources in a timely manner.
Ensures that systems, materials and people are in place to provide for quality employee training. Utilizes the company specific hourly training programs.
Minimizes employee turnover by:
Hiring candidates who possess pre-designed characteristics and have a good work history;
Being personally involved in the orientation and training of all new employees;
Providing a positive work environment for all employees;
Identifying and addressing employee issues in a timely manner.

Provides clear goals and expectations to the management team through ongoing communications and weekly meetings.
Prepares and executes monthly management schedules that ensure proper management coverage to execute quality operations.
Assists the Director of Operations with interviewing management candidates as requested.
Conducts shadow management and related training programs for Managers-In-Training as assigned.
Develops managers to operate a shift at or above Company standards through ongoing training and coaching.
Conducts monthly safety training for all management and hourly employees and forwards acknowledgement forms to Human Resources in a timely manner.
Sets professional development goals for each manager assigned to restaurant and conducts performance appraisals on an annual basis and intermittently as needed.
Coaches, counsels, and properly documents performance, attendance, or behavioral issues encountered with management and hourly employees.
Maintains proper employee staffing levels in the restaurant at all times.
Reviews and approves hourly employee performance appraisals.
Reviews and approves hourly employee performance counseling and terminations.
Operates the restaurant with uncompromising integrity and superior credibility, adhering at all times to Schlotzsky’s policies and procedures.
